SubjectRe: [PATCH v6 28/30] drm/rockchip: Disable PSR from reboot notifier
Hi Andrzej, Tomasz

2018-04-16 15:12 GMT+02:00 Tomasz Figa <tfiga@chromium.org>:
> Hi Andrzej,
>
> On Mon, Apr 16, 2018 at 6:57 PM Andrzej Hajda <a.hajda@samsung.com> wrote:
>
>> On 05.04.2018 11:49, Enric Balletbo i Serra wrote:
>> > From: Tomasz Figa <tfiga@chromium.org>
>> >
>> > It looks like the driver subsystem detaches devices from power domains
>> > at shutdown without consent of the drivers.
>
>> It looks bit strange. Could you elaborate more on it. Could you show the
>> code performing the detach?
>
> It not only looks strange, but it is strange. The code was present in 4.4:
>
> https://elixir.bootlin.com/linux/v4.4.128/source/drivers/base/platform.c#L553
>
> but was apparently removed in 4.5:
>
> https://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/next/linux-next.git/commit/drivers/base/platform.c?h=next-20180416&id=2d30bb0b3889adf09b342722b2ce596c0763bc93
>
> So we might not need this patch anymore.
>

Right, seems that we don't need this patch anymore, I'll do more few
tests and likely remove this patch from this series. Thanks for
catching this.
